    The Voice of Uncle Sam, the Image of Steve Jobs : The Changing Meaning and Reception of American Media and Cultural Products in the Czech Lands from the 1960s to the Present

  • Original language description

    The author focuses on the reception of American cultural products, such as the programs offered by The Voice of America, Hollywood films, American literature and music in the period before and after 1989.
